JAMES HAWKER'S JOURNAL: A VICTORIAN POACHER. Edited by Garth Christian.
(1961) 1962 reprint. small 8vo (127 x 191mm). Ppxxii,114. B/w illustrations by Lynton Lamb. Two-tone mottled cream-yellow boards, black cloth spine titled in gilt. D/w price, 12s 6d net in U.K. only.
James Hawker was born in 1836 and died in 1921. He lived in Oadby near Leicester most of his life and was a famous poacher throughout Leicestershire and Northamptonshire.
